Position Summary

U.S. AutoForce, a division of U.S. Venture, Inc., has over 100 years of experience in distributing tires, undercar parts, and lubricants to independent tire retailers, auto repair shops, and automotive dealerships.

Schedule

Monday through Friday, 7:00 AM to 3:30 PM, with rotating Saturdays. Schedules may change based on business needs and may require overtime.

Job Responsibilities
  • Load, unload, and stock tires and auto parts using industrial vehicles like forklifts or picker equipment.
  • Use scanners for inventory control and assist with inventory management.
  • Lift up to 50 pounds consistently and occasionally up to 80 pounds, with team lifts or mechanical aids for heavy tires.
  • Push up to 40 pounds when handling barrels or agricultural tires.
  • Work safely at heights up to 25 feet on stock racks.
  • Remain on your feet for extended periods and work overtime as needed.
  • Maintain safety standards and contribute to a safe work environment.
  • Assist other departments as needed.
Driving Responsibilities
  • Operate box trucks under 26,001 pounds and make 10-20 deliveries daily.
  • Keep accurate logs and records, including driver logs and fuel records.
  • Deliver products punctually and safely in all weather conditions.
  • Perform pre-trip and post-trip vehicle inspections.
  • Use provided handheld devices to fulfill deliveries.
  • Communicate effectively with customers, coworkers, and management.
  • Collect payments upon delivery.
  • Perform other related tasks as assigned.

Physical Demands & Work Environment

Must be able to lift up to 50 pounds regularly and 80 pounds occasionally, exert pushing force up to 40 pounds, and operate equipment safely. Protective gear provided, and safety adherence is mandatory. Work may involve exposure to weather, noise, fumes, and require safety equipment like steel-toe boots, vests, and harnesses.

Qualifications
  • Must be 21 or older
  • At least 1 year of professional driving experience and passing a company road test
  • Warehouse or logistics experience preferred
  • Valid driver’s license and clean driving record
  • Ability to operate powered industrial trucks and obtain certification
  • Ability to lift and push specified weights safely
  • Customer service skills and ability to work overtime
  • Pass pre-employment drug test (excluding THC)
  • Valid DOT Medical Card or ability to obtain one
